Blackstone, a global investment firm, has acquired Aadhar Housing Finance Ltd., one of India's largest housing finance companies, for an undisclosed amount. Aadhar Housing Finance, established in 2010, specializes in providing home financing solutions to low-income communities across India. It serves over 250,000 customers through a network of more than 500 branches across 20 states and union territories. The company manages assets worth 21,121 Cr, has a loan book of approximately a billion rupees, and caters to individuals with monthly incomes ranging from INR 5000 to INR 50000. Aadhar debuted on the stock market in 2024.
